We have not explored the menu too deeply, and usually start with the chips and salsa, which are not complimentary as they are at most Mexican restaurants. The chips are thicker than many places, lightly salted and the salsa is more like chunks of tomato than a sauce. We enjoy it. Cocktails are a nice treat here, and we always enjoy what we order, whether it be a paloma, margarita or something else. Service from the bar tends to be slow and our waitress forgot to bring our drink, until we reminded her what was missing. For entrees, we usually get the tacos, as you can mix and match whatever you like including how many you want. Rice and beans can be added for an additional charge. I always get the carnitas and while good, I just wished the restaurant would be a little more reserved with salt. They were just shy of too salty to eat, something I can't recall on previous orders. The other tacos were properly seasoned. For dessert we had the chocolate tres leches, it had a coconut sauce and peanut clusters so all my favorites. It was tasty, very rich and a generous portion which I could not finish. Overall a good restaurant with a talented chef. If you are vegetarian, you know how hard it is to find delicious creative vegetarian entrees. The mushroom birria tacos were to die for and are served with house made cashew cheese. The mushrooms were even locally sourced as were a lot of their ingredients. And not to forget the drinks, the El Magico margarita was delicious. Go early they don't take reservations for parties of less than 5 people.
